Second time's the charm as ESR-Reit, Sabana Reit revive merger proposal
Enlarged Reit will have market value of S$1.8b and free float of S$1.3b, increasing its shot at EPRA NAREIT index inclusion
Singapore
ESR-REIT and Sabana Shari'ah Compliant Industrial Real Estate Investment Trust (Sabana Reit) are taking another crack at a merger after earlier talks in 2017 fell through, seeking to build an enlarged entity to stave off headwinds in a post-Covid world.
The proposal is the latest among S-Reits, with recent mergers including OUE Commercial Reit and OUE Hospitality as well as Ascott Residence Trust and Ascendas Hospitality Trust.
